This extensive guide explores whatever one needs to learn about making the right choice for a youngster's sleep.What is a Baby Cot Bed?Initially glance, a cot bed might look remarkably comparable to a standard baby cot. However, the crucial difference lies in its longevity. A standard cot is generally developed for babies up to about 18 months to 2 years of ages. In contrast, a baby cot bed is larger and created to grow with the kid. A lot of cot beds can quickly transition from a secure enclosed cot for a newborn into a toddler bed appropriate for kids approximately 4 or even 5 years of ages. Extraordinary Value for MoneyDue to the fact that a cot bed covers numerous developmental phases, moms and dads do not require to purchase an intermediate toddler bed. Purchasing one strong cot bed from birth conserves money in the long run compared to purchasing a newborn crib followed by a young child bed a year or 2 later.2. Smooth Transition to IndependenceMoving a young child from a cot with high sides straight into a big-kid bed can be daunting. Cot beds sit lower to the ground and keep the familiar headboard and footboard of the original cot. This familiarity makes the shift much less intimidating for a young child.3. Strong and SpaciousCot beds are developed to be larger than basic cots. Slats ought to be spaced no greater than 6.5 cm apart to avoid a baby's head from getting trapped.Adjustable Mattress Base Heights: Newborns need the bed mattress to be at its highest setting so parents do not strain their backs raising them. As the baby finds out to sit and pull themselves as much as stand, the mattress base must be decreased to avoid falls.Teething Rails: Babies like to chew on things when their teeth start to emerge. Search for cot beds with protective plastic teething rails along the top edges to protect the wood and your baby's gums.Material and Build Quality: Solid wood alternatives (like pine, beech, or oak) use exceptional resilience compared to cheap particle board. Keep it Clear: Avoid putting pillows, heavy quilts, most recommended Cribs bumper pads, or packed animals in the cot with a newborn. Space Temperature: Keep the nursery between 16 ° C and 20 ° C( 60 ° F to 68 ° F) and use a well-fitted baby sleeping bag or light blankets embeded firmly below chest height. While some parents choose a smaller sized Moses basket for the first few months (especially for bedside sleeping), a newborn can sleep securely in a cot bed from the first day, supplied the bed mattress is firm and fulfills security standards.Q2: Do cot beds require an unique mattress size?A: Yes. Standard cot beds typically need a mattress determining 140 cm x 70 cm, which is bigger than a standard cot bed mattress (120 cm x 60 cm).
